在配置文件中添加多个IPv6地址后,只有一个生效的可能原因是你没有正确地配置每个IPv6地址的前缀长度。每个IPv6地址都应该有唯一的前缀长度来指定网络子网的范围。
请确保在lo接口配置文件中按照以下格式为每个IPv6地址进行配置:
inet6 <IPv6地址>/<前缀长度> scope global
例如:
inet6 2001:db8::1/64 scope global
inet6 2001:db8::2/64 scope global
如果仍然无法生效,请检查以下几点:
- 确认是否已重新加载网络配置或重启系统使更改生效。
- 检查网络接口是否正常工作,并使用命令
ip -6 addr show dev lo
来验证lo接口上关联的所有IPv6地址。
如果问题仍然存在,请提供更多详细信息,如操作系统和具体配置文件内容,以便更好地帮助你解决问题。
内容由零声教学AI助手提供,问题来源于学员提问